ALEXANDRIA, Va., Jan. 28 -- United States Patent no. 12,536,906, issued on Jan. 27, was assigned to Lytx Inc. (San Diego).

"Unified map for driving efficiency and safety" was invented by Daniel Witriol (Kirkland, Wash.), Amir Sultan (Winnipeg, Canada) and Emily Yang (San Diego).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"The present application discloses a method, system, and computer system for performing an active measure for managing one or more vehicles.
